"Here’s the point. We are on our own. There isn’t going to be a Woodward and Bernstein to turn darkness to light and save the day this time. The world just doesn’t work that way anymore. If anything, there’s too much light, and it’s blinding us to the danger we’re in. For the news media has lit up our politics like the clear blue sky – less in the name of fair and objective journalism, and more in the name of Arthur C. Neilson."
Tom Heehler
